Julie Friend
Julie joined Shooting Star Children’s Hospice in February 2025. As a Volunteer Research Assistant, Julie works with the Research Team, contributing to the research undertaken by the team and supporting them to develop and deliver a broad range of research projects across the organisation.
Prior to joining us, Julie had acquired extensive experience as a commercial and results driven Senior HR Leader within the Corporate environment. She has held multiple global and regional HR roles across different industries, leading projects and partnering with leaders and executives on their strategy, organisational design, change management, talent management, restructuring activities, mergers and acquisitions and company culture.
Julie enjoys applying her corporate HR skills to research, undertaking data collection, literature reviews, and methodology to further the research in paediatric palliative care, to improve the quality and effectiveness of hospice services.
Aside from her corporate career and in addition to volunteering with Shooting Star, Julie’s voluntary work includes supporting adults with their mental wellbeing in Surrey and serving on her local Patient Participation Group. Previous voluntary experience includes acting as a Trustee for a Guildford based charity, completing funding applications, engaging with local businesses and working in a hospital in Belize.
